Pricked 8, battled 6, petted 5, and set 2 free last night. Only my third trip of the year... sure was easier to get out every night back when I was unemployed... All fish came on the black/silver Challenger Jr. minnow, cranked slow with pauses on the north shore of Oneida Lake. Oh, was only out for about an hour... might have to try it again tonight.
